Abstract
RECOMMENDATION: Yes. The number of individuals in the OR and door openings (DO) during total joint arthroplasty (TJA) are correlated to the number of airborne particles in the OR. Elevated airborne particles in the OR can predispose to subsequent PJIs. Therefore, OR traffic should be kept to a minimum. Multiple strategies, outlined below, should be implemented to reduce traffic in the OR during orthopaedic procedures.
